What is a travel system?

A travel system is a stroller that can accommodate a car seat for your baby, and some come with a carrycot. It's an excellent choice for new parents as it means you can easily move your baby from the car to the pushchair without disturbing them - perfect for those quick trips to the shops or do an early morning run.

A quality travel system can be glued to your pushchair frame and fit snugly into your car. This will ensure a comfortable journey for your child. It's also a convenient choice since that you only need to buy one thing when getting ready for the arrival of your child - and it'll usually reduce your expenses too.

What are the seat recline options?

If you decide to go with a travel system that includes a carrycot, make sure the pushchair seat is fully reclined to ensure your baby is able to sleep comfortably and is at the recommended lie-flat position for spinal and respiratory development. Consider whether the handlebar can be adjusted so that it is comfortable for you, your partner or anyone else who uses it often.

Most 'from birth' pushchairs include a reversible seat so that you can decide whether your child sits parent-facing (to help them develop their communication skills) or facing the world to stimulate their curiosity and let them see where they are going. Some travel systems have a reversible seating unit that clips directly to the frame of the pushchair without having to remove it. This lets you effortlessly transfer your baby from the car to the stroller, and in reverse.

Not all infant car seats are compatible with all pushchairs. Some travel systems come with all the adaptors you require included in the box, while others may require them to be purchased separately. Check the product details, or ask your local retailer.

How easy is it to attach a car seat or a carrycot?

The majority of cheap pushchairs that are 'from birth' can be connected to a baby car seat or carrycot to allow easy transitions from your vehicle to the street. This is ideal for infants as it allows them to sleep in a flat position.

Most travel systems are sold with a separate stroller seat. However, a few, like the Doona or the Evenflo DualRide, feature one-piece designs so that the car seat folds into a pushchair. Most travel systems include a separate stroller, but some, like the Doona or the Evenflo Shyft DualRide have a single-piece design that permits the car seat to be folded into the pushchair, and then folded back into base of the vehicle.

If you decide to put a car seat or carrycot on your pushchair, be sure to carefully read the instructions and follow the weight, age and size restrictions. Also, be sure to verify if your pushchair or car seat has been removed as part of an recall for safety.

What does it look Like?

A travel system bundle offers ease of use, security and savings. These bundles are created by brands or retailers, with each piece carefully selected to work perfectly together. This means you won't need to research what car seat is compatible for your dream pushchair or searching for a footmuff that matches or changing bags.

They normally consist of a frame for a pushchair that can be used with the group 0+ car seat and usually include a carrycot or a seat unit which can be used facing forward or towards the parent depending on your preference (or regulations, since rear-facing in the car is recommended up to 15 months). Some of them can be converted into a tandem twin if you're expecting more than one child.

If you intend to drive a lot and walking, a travel system is a good choice. It is easy to move your child from the car to the pushchair with car seat and vice versa without having to disturb them or find a secure parking spot. They can also save you space in your car's boot, making it easier for you to go shopping or do the school run.
